Trouble Opening a .POWER File? These Steps Will Help
Since .POWER files come from different programs, they aren't universally openable.
- Identify the Source: A photographer might send it as an image collection, while a developer may use it for app configurations.
- Check the Header: Inspect the first bytes in a text or hex editor:
- "PK" implies a ZIP-based archive.
- Readable XML/JSON suggests a settings file.
- Random symbols indicate a proprietary binary.
- Use the Original Software: The creating program is usually required; try Goo Picture Library or a code editor, but if unsure, ask the sender.
